On Fre, 2008-02-08 at 10:51 +0530, rohit h wrote:
> Hi,
> I am a kernel newbie.
> I tried to insmod a C++ module containing classes, inheritance.
> I am getting 'unresolved symbol' error when I use the 'new' keyword.
> What could the problem be?
That you used C++ is the problem. Use plain C and the gcc.
> What kind of runtime support is needed ( arm linux kernel)? Is a
> patch available for it?
Google for "linux kernel c++" and read on - this has been discussed
several times on this list.
